Purchase Plan, & 401(k) with automatic matching JOB SUMMARY This is
an outside sales position responsible for promoting the company's
products and services and for building relationships with new and
existing accounts. The main focus is to help Sysco customers
succeed while achieving sales and profit goals established by the
company. This position may require working some non-traditional
hours (evening, weekends, and holidays) to successfully meet
customers' needs. RESPONSIBILITIES Develop new business, penetrate
existing accounts, and minimize lost business to achieve profitable
sales growth and special objectives within assigned territory. Seek
and qualify prospects following company account stratification
goals. Research customer business needs and develops a mix of
products and service to meet needs. Evaluate market trends and
recommend products to customers, based on business needs and goals.
Be informed of market conditions, product innovations, and
competitors' products, prices, and sales; share information with
customers as part of value-added services provided. Answer
customers' questions about products, prices, availability, and
product use. Provide product information and practical training to
customer personnel. Drive personal vehicle to customer accounts,
conventions, company meetings, etc. Communicate and collect
accounts receivable as necessary, working with the credit
department and client; collect all balances due based on approved
credit terms. Manage deliveries to the routing schedule published
by the transportation department; troubleshoot any problems that
occur during the order process (for example, out of stock items,
special order items, low inventory, etc.). Participate in company
functions, promotions, customer visits, and customer events. Attend
and participate in general sales and district meetings. Engage in
ongoing training sessions. Assist with the training of new
employees as requested. Review and analyze daily and weekly reports
such as special-order requests, customer bid files, and sales/gross
profit margin data. Perform administrative duties, such as
preparing sales budgets and reports, maintaining sales records,
processing credits, and pick-up requests, preparing sales quotes
and menu suggestions, and filing reports. Other duties may be
